How an app in South Korea will let victims track their stalkers
Summary
South Korea has launched a new government app that lets stalking victims track their stalkers’ locations in real time. Officials hope this app will provide better protection, but some experts question if it will truly increase safety.Key Facts
- The app allows victims to see where their stalkers are in real time on their phones.
- It was created and released by the South Korean government.
- The goal is to give stronger protection to people who experience stalking.
- Some experts doubt the app’s effectiveness in actually preventing harm.
- The app’s use involves personal safety and privacy concerns.
- Victims’ identities can be protected while using the app.
- South Korea is trying new technology to address stalking issues.
- The app is part of a broader effort to improve victim support services.
